1FG7

CRYSTAL STRUCTURE OF L-HISTIDINOL PHOSPHATE AMINOTRANSFERASE WITH PYRIDOXAL-5'-PHOSPHATE

Summary for 1FG7
Entry DOI10.2210/pdb1fg7/pdb
Related1FG3
DescriptorHISTIDINOL PHOSPHATE AMINOTRANSFERASE, 4'-DEOXY-4'-AMINOPYRIDOXAL-5'-PHOSPHATE (3 entities in total)
Functional Keywordsaminotransferase, hisc, histidine biosynthesis, pyridoxal phosphate, montreal-kingston bacterial structural genomics initiative, bsgi, structural genomics, transferase
Biological sourceEscherichia coli
Total number of polymer chains1
Total formula weight39829.74
Authors
Sivaraman, J.,Cygler, M.,Montreal-Kingston Bacterial Structural Genomics Initiative (BSGI) (deposition date: 2000-07-28, release date: 2001-08-22, Last modification date: 2017-10-04)
Primary citationSivaraman, J.,Li, Y.,Larocque, R.,Schrag, J.D.,Cygler, M.,Matte, A.
Crystal structure of histidinol phosphate aminotransferase (HisC) from Escherichia coli, and its covalent complex with pyridoxal-5'-phosphate and l-histidinol phosphate.
J.Mol.Biol., 311:761-776, 2001
